CALCulate<Chn>:MATH:FUNCtion
<Mode>
CALCulate<Chn>:MATH:FORMatted:FUNCtion
<Mode>
Defines a simple mathematical trace based on the active trace and its active memory
trace. The first command applies to raw, unformatted trace data (complex data), the
second to formatted trace data. Both methods can be combined.
To apply the trace math, the corresponding mathematical mode must be switched on
using

Suffix:
<Chn>
.
Channel number used to identify the active trace
Parameters:
<Mode>
NORMal | ADD | SUBTract | MULTiply | DIVide
NORMal
–
Math. trace = active data trace
ADD
–
Math. trace = data + memory
SUBTract
–
Math. trace = data - memory
MULTiply
–
Math. trace = data * memory
DIVide
–
Math. trace = data / memory
When set to
NORMal
, the corresponding mathematical mode is
turned
OFF
, otherwise it is turned
ON
.
*RST:
NORMal
